Preparation time : 30 minutes Serves : 2 Traditional Quinoa - ½ cup Green Lentil - ½ cup Garlic Salt - 1 ½ tsp Lemon Juice - 2 tsp Frozen Sweet Corn - ¼ cup Red pepper flakes - 1 tsp Spring onions and Cilantro - for garnish

Cook the quinoa according to the package instructions. (I have used 1 cup of water for ½ cup quinoa and cooked for about 15 minutes till the water is absorbed) Pressure cook the green lentil for 2 whistles or add water in pot along with lentil and cook in medium flame for 30 minutes. See that the water is at least half inch above the lentil. In bowl add the cooked quinoa, lentil, garlic salt, lemon juice, sweet corn, red pepper flakes and mix well. Garnish it with spring onions and coriander leaves. Quinoa lentil salad is ready. Serve and enjoy.

Tip:

I have prepared oil free salad. You can add 1 tablespoon of olive oil if desired. I have used garlic salt coarse ground with parsley. You can chop 2 garlic cloves and saute them in teaspoon of oil till its golden in color and add it to salad along with the regular salt instead.
